1. A cargo transport rear frame defining a rear cargo opening, the cargo transport rear frame comprising:
a pair of posts spaced apart in a width direction, each of the pair of posts extending in a height direction;
an upper cross member extending along the width direction between respective upper ends of the pair of posts; and
a rear bolster extending along the width direction between respective lower ends of the pair of posts such that the rear bolster is spaced below the upper cross member in the height direction, wherein the pair of posts, the upper cross member, and the rear bolster bound the rear cargo opening,
wherein the rear bolster has a first side facing in a forward direction that is perpendicular to both the width and height directions, and the rear bolster has a second side facing in a rearward direction to be exposed to a rear side of the cargo transport rear frame,
wherein the rear bolster comprises a sheet metal stamping including a base surface and a relief embossed in the rearward direction from the base surface to form a loading dock engagement feature configured to withstand repeated loading dock impacts.
